AI's Economic Potential vs. Current Reality
Artificial Intelligence is frequently compared to the Industrial Revolution, with predictions of an even greater and faster transformative impact on the economy. However, the initial evidence suggests a more subdued performance. In the first half of 2026, despite substantial double-digit annualized increases in business spending on technology equipment and intellectual property related to AI, the economy registered an annual growth rate of only 1.75%. Real consumer spending rose by a mere 1.8%, while job creation amounted to 450,000 payroll positions, and productivity growth lingered at about 1%. These figures indicate that while AI is influencing economic activity, its broad contributions to growth, jobs, and productivity are, so far, not as revolutionary as anticipated.
AI's Impact on Employment and Workforce
A significant concern highlighted in the article is AI's effect on employment, particularly in white-collar sectors. AI is reportedly already managing or assisting with extensive volumes of tasks traditionally performed by humans, enabling some companies to reduce their headcount or avoid expanding their workforce. This trend sharply contrasts with the Industrial Revolution, which historically led to massive job creation. If AI continues to facilitate workforce reduction or stagnate job growth, it could substantially undermine overall economic performance by limiting the number of employed individuals, thereby impacting income generation and consumption patterns.
Economic Arithmetic: Consumer Spending and AI Investment
The economic implications of AI on consumer spending are critical, given that real consumer spending constitutes 70% of overall GDP growth. The article argues that if sluggish job growth due to AI causes even a modest decrease in consumer spending (e.g., 100 basis points), investments in AI models and infrastructure would need to increase dramatically—by three to four times the current rate—just to maintain the same GDP growth rate. Such an unprecedented surge in AI investment would likely exceed most companies' current cash flows, necessitating immense private sector borrowing. This raises a fundamental question about the practicality and essentiality of such AI investments if the technology simultaneously impedes the growth of its main market: the consumer, through stagnating job creation.
Balancing AI Progress with Job Market Stability
The key challenge for AI's long-term success is to strike a balance where it enhances GDP output and productivity without adversely affecting the job market to the point of significantly decreasing consumer spending. The precise trade-off required for this balance is currently uncertain. Historically, major infrastructure booms and new technologies have taken years to fully realize their economic and financial benefits. A consistent pattern observed throughout history is that past innovations have ultimately created more jobs than they eliminated. Therefore, for AI to be considered genuinely successful and economically beneficial in the long run, it must demonstrate a similar capability to generate a net increase in employment opportunities.
